![]() The domestication of cotton allowed for textiles of vibrant colors to be created. The game had a ritualistic significance and was often accompanied with human sacrifice. Evidence of these ball games is found throughout Mesoamerica, and the performance of these games is related to many origin myths of the Mesoamerican people. Rubber trees and cotton plants were useful for making culturally significant products such as rubber balls for Mesoamerican ball games and textiles, respectively. Growing these three crops together helps to retain nutrients in the soil. Maize, beans, and squash form a triad of products, commonly referred to as the " Three Sisters". Squashes provided an excellent source of protein to the ancient Mesoamericans, as well as to people today.Īnother major food source in Mesoamerica are beans. The bottle gourd provided storage space for collecting seeds for grinding or planting as well as a means of carrying water. Another important squash that was domesticated in the early Archaic period was the bottle gourd ( Lagenaria siceraria). These finds date back to 8000 BC, the beginning of the Archaic period, and are related to today's pumpkin. Smith discovered evidence of domesticated squash ( Cucurbita pepo), in Guilá Naquitz cave in Oaxaca. Squash and beans were also important staples of the ancient Mesoamerican agricultural diet and along with maize, are often referred to as the " Three Sisters".Įarly and culturally significant domestic plants Īnother important crop in Mesoamerican agriculture is squash. The most important plant in ancient Mesoamerica, was, unarguably, maize. This sedentary lifestyle reliant on agriculture allowed permanent settlements to grow into villages and provided the opportunity for division of labor and social stratification. Eventually, the Mesoamerican people established a sedentary lifestyle based on plant domestication and cultivation, supplemented with small game hunting. These larger settlements required a greater quantity of food, consequently leading to an even greater reliance on domesticated crops. The reliability of cultivated plants allowed hunting and gathering micro-bands to establish permanent settlements and to increase in size. The latter could have happened as certain plant seeds were eaten and not fully digested, causing these plants to grow wherever human habitation would take them.Īs the Archaic period progressed, cultivation of plant foods became increasingly important to the people of Mesoamerica. The former could have been done by bringing a wild plant closer to a camp site, or to a frequented area, so it was easier access and collect. The cultivation of plants could have been started purposefully, or by accident. The cultivation of these plants provided security to the Mesoamericans, allowing them to increase surplus of " starvation foods" near seasonal camps this surplus could be utilized when hunting was bad, during times of drought, and when resources were low. However, the nomadic lifestyle that dominated the late Pleistocene and the early Archaic slowly transitioned into a more sedentary lifestyle as the hunter gatherer micro-bands in the region began to cultivate wild plants. At the beginning of the Archaic period, the Early Hunters of the late Pleistocene era (50,000–10,000 BC) led nomadic lifestyles, relying on hunting and gathering for sustenance. Agriculture in Mesoamerica dates to the Archaic period of Mesoamerican chronology (8000–2000 BC). ![]()

The entourage spent time at clubs and the hotel pool, accumulating a $20,000 hotel bill by the time they departed. In October 1972, Bowie and an entourage of 46 people (including Mike Garson's family and Iggy Pop) stayed at the Beverly Hills Hotel on Sunset Boulevard in Los Angeles, California, for a week. Because of this, many of the tracks were influenced by America, and his perceptions of the country. He composed most of the tracks for the follow-up record on the road during the US tour in late 1972. To support the album, Bowie embarked on the Ziggy Stardust Tour in both the UK and the US. With the release of his album The Rise and Fall of Ziggy Stardust and the Spiders from Mars and his performance of " Starman" on the BBC television programme Top of the Pops in early July 1972, David Bowie was launched to stardom. It is notable for showing Bowie's declining mental state during this period, due to his growing cocaine addiction. "Cracked Actor" provided the name for a 1975 documentary of the same name, directed by Alan Yentob. Bowie revived the skull-and-sunglasses routine for the 1983 Serious Moonlight Tour, a performance of which appears in the concert video Serious Moonlight (1984). Performances from this tour have appeared on the live albums David Live (1974) and Cracked Actor (Live Los Angeles '74) (2017). His biographers have compared the routine to Hamlet. For his 1974 Diamond Dogs Tour, he performed it wearing sunglasses and holding a skull, which he would proceed to French kiss. A hard rock song primarily led by guitar, the song describes an aging Hollywood star's encounter with a prostitute, featuring many allusions to sex and drugs.īowie performed the song frequently. Co-produced by Bowie and Ken Scott, it was recorded in January 1973 at Trident Studios in London with his backing band the Spiders from Mars – comprising Mick Ronson, Trevor Bolder and Woody Woodmansey. The song was written during Bowie's stay in Los Angeles, California during the American leg of the Ziggy Stardust Tour in October 1972. The track was also issued as a single in Eastern Europe by RCA Records in June that year. Cracked Actor" is a song by English musician David Bowie, released on his sixth studio album Aladdin Sane (1973). He was again designated for assignment by Seattle on June 8, after going 3-for-26 with 1 home run. The new clause, in which a player can’t be claimed off waivers for a second time by the same ballclub within a season until each of the other teams have passed on him, is colloquially known as the Jacob Nottingham Rule. Nottingham being claimed off waivers twice by the Mariners within a span of a month exposed a loophole which was closed by the Collective Bargaining Agreement (CBA) that resolved the 2021–22 MLB lockout. On May 20, 2021, he was again claimed off waivers by the Seattle Mariners. On May 13, he was again designated for assignment by Milwaukee. In the 8th inning of the same game, he hit a two-run homer off of Mike Kickham, giving him his first career multi-homer game in his return to Milwaukee. In his first at-bat back with Milwaukee, he hit a solo home run off of Los Angeles Dodgers starter Julio Urías. The Brewers, who were dealing with injuries to starter Omar Narváez and backup Manny Piña, immediately added Nottingham to the active roster. The next day, the Mariners traded him to the Brewers in exchange for cash considerations. On May 1, the Mariners designated him for assignment. On April 28, he was claimed off waivers by the Seattle Mariners. After spending the beginning of the 2021 season recovering from the surgery, he was designated for assignment by Milwaukee on April 22. In the 2020–21 offseason, Nottingham underwent surgery on the radial collateral ligament on his left thumb. Nottingham appeared in a career-high 20 games in 2020, hitting. On the year, Nottingham only registered 6 at-bats, getting 2 hits including his first MLB home run off of Josh Tomlin of the Atlanta Braves. On May 17, in a game against the Atlanta Braves, he hit his first career home run. He began the 2019 season in AAA with the San Antonio Missions, but was recalled from AAA on May 16, 2019. Nottingham finished the year with 4 hits in 20 at-bats. ![]() The Brewers promoted him to the major leagues on April 16, 2018. ![]() Nottingham began the 2018 season with the Colorado Springs Sky Sox of the Class AAA Pacific Coast League. The Brewers added him to their 40-man roster after the 2017 season. 209 with nine home runs and 48 RBIs in 101 games. Nottingham returned to Biloxi in 2017 where he struggled, batting only. After the season, the Brewers assigned Nottingham to the Salt River Rafters of the Arizona Fall League. Nottingham spent 2016 with the Biloxi Shuckers where he hit. On February 12, 2016, the Athletics traded Nottingham and Bubba Derby to the Milwaukee Brewers for Khris Davis. 316 batting average with 17 home runs, 82 RBIs, and an. In 119 total games between Quad City, Lancaster, and Stockton, Nottingham posted a. Oakland assigned him to the Stockton Ports, where he finished the season. Prior to the 2015 trade deadline, the Astros traded Nottingham and Daniel Mengden to the Oakland Athletics for Scott Kazmir. He was promoted to the Lancaster JetHawks in late June. 230 with five home runs and 28 RBIs, and he started 2015 with the Quad Cities River Bandits. In 2014, he played for the Greeneville Astros, where he batted. 247 with one home run and 20 RBIs in 44 games. He made his professional debut that year with the Gulf Coast Astros, where he spent the whole season, batting. The Houston Astros selected him in the sixth round of the 2013 Major League Baseball Draft. He accepted an offer to play college baseball at the University of Oklahoma. Nottingham attended Redlands High School in Redlands, California. He has previously played in Major League Baseball (MLB) for the Milwaukee Brewers and Seattle Mariners. Jacob Andrew Nottingham (born April 3, 1995) is an American professional baseball catcher and first baseman in the Seattle Mariners organization.
